  2. stand up for something/someone phrasal verb with stand verb uk / stænd / us / stænd / stood | stood (also stick up for something/someone) Add to word list B2 to defend or support a particular idea or a person who is being criticized or attacked: It's high time we all stood up for our rights around here.

    What does'stand a person up' mean?Other meanings of 'stand [someone] up' As choster notes in another answer to this question, "stand [someone] up" could also mean, in the late 1800s, "rob [someone]" or (presumably as a later development from that meaning) "ask [someone] for money as a gift or favor."
